Great Music Covers to Help Protect Children of War
There's something special about purchasing an album that has a good selection of songs from various artists and from which the proceeds go to support a good cause. In this case the album is the new release titled War Child: Heroes, Vol. 1.In a campaign to bring attention and fundraising to non-profit efforts that help protect and rehabiliate children of war, a dozen artists and bands came to the plate. Among them include TV On The Radio, The Like, Rufus Wainwright, Yeah Yeah Yeahs, Lily Allen, Mick Jagger, Hot Chip, The Kooks and Beck all recorded songs for the War Child cause.

Tracklist
1. Beck (BOB DYLAN - Leopard-Skin Pill-Box Hat)
2. The Kooks (THE KINKS - Victoria)
3. The Hold Steady (BRUCE SPRINGSTEEN - Atlantic City)
4. Hot Chip (JOY DIVISION - Transmission)
5. Lily Allen featuring Mick Jones (THE CLASH - Straight To Hell)
6. YEAH YEAH YEAHS (THE RAMONES - Sheena Is A Punk Rocker)
7. Franz Ferdinand (BLONDIE - Call Me)
8. Duffy (PAUL McCARTNEY - Live And Let Die)
9. Estelle (STEVIE WONDER - Superstition)
10. Rufus Wainwright (BRIAN WILSON - Wonderful/Song For Children)
11. Scissor Sisters (ROXY MUSIC - Do The Strand)
12. Peaches (IGGY POP - Search And Destroy)
13. Adam Cohen (LEONARD COHEN - Take This Waltz)
14. Elbow (U2 - Running To Stand Still)
15. The Like (ELVIS COSTELLO - You Belong To Me)
16. TV On The Radio (DAVID BOWIE - Heroes)
